PyCon 2010: Connecting The Python Community

The Python Software Foundation is proud to present the annual Python community conference, PyCon 2010. PyCon 2010 will be held at the Hyatt Regency Atlanta in downtown Atlanta, Georgia from February 17 through 25.

Meta Shares its Mixed-Reality Meta Horizon OS to Third Parties

Opening up the operating system that powers its Meta Quest devices to third-party hardware makers, Meta aims to create a larger ecosystem and make it easier for developers to create apps for larger audiences.

Reliable Web App Pattern: Now Optimizes Azure Migration with Enhanced Infrastructure and Security

Microsoft has released an updated version of the Reliable Web App (RWA) Pattern for .NET. This update focuses on improving production infrastructure and network security in response to as reported, user feedback, making Azure migration easier for .NET web apps.

Devnexus 2024 Celebrates 20 Years of Java Developer Conferences

Celebrating its 20th year, Devnexus 2024 was held from April 9-11, 2024 at the Georgia World Congress Center in Atlanta, Georgia. The event featured speakers from the Java community who delivered workshops and talks on tracks such as: Agile; Architecture; Artificial Intelligence; Cloud Technology; Core Java; Jakarta EE; Core Java; and Security.

What's New in Red Hat OpenShift Q1 2024 Enhancements

RedHat has announced the general availability of Red Hat OpenShift 4.15, based on Kubernetes 1.28 and CRI-O 1.28. Red Hat OpenShift is an application platform that allows developers and DevOps to build, and deploy applications.

Axion Processor: Google Announces Its First Arm-Based CPU

During the recent Google Next '24 conference, Google unveiled Axion, its first custom Arm-based CPUs designed for data centers. Utilizing the Arm Neoverse V2 CPU architecture, the new processor will be available to customers later this year.
